WebMay 1, 2009 · Hot and humid environmental conditions stress the lactating dairy cow and reduce intake of the nutrients necessary to support milk yield and body maintenance. In Georgia, weather conditions are sufficiently hot and humid to reduce performance of dairy cows for five months or more each year. How many degrees above normal is this body temperature on the Celsius scale? arrow_forward nowcast covid usahttp://wdmc.org/2013/Managing%20Heat%20Stress%20and%20Its%20Impact%20on%20Cow%20Behavior.pdf nowcast election mapsWebThe normal temperature of an adult cow is around 38.5°C (approx 101.5°F. A temperature over 39.5°C (103°F) may indicate an infectious or inflammatory process.
